Strategic Profile

GeoVax develops vaccines and immunotherapies using a modified vaccinia ankara virus-like particle vaccine platform. Development programs focus on vaccines against COVID-19, hemorrhagic fever viruses, malaria, zika, and HIV, as well as immunotherapy programs targeting tumor-associated antigen MUC1 and HPV-induced cancers. As a pre-commercial clinical-stage company, GeoVax relies on government contracts and institutional partnerships rather than traditional commercial revenue streams.

Cyborg Score Rationale

GeoVax had approximately $5 million in cash at the end of Q3 2025 with high cash burn rates from R&D, increasing the likelihood of future stock offerings and significant dilution. The company is pre-revenue with no approved products, relying entirely on grant funding and equity offerings to fund operations. Stock performance has been severely negative, with warrants trading at negligible levels.

Top Insights

  • GEO-CM04S1 is being advanced in Phase 2 trials across three patient populations: primary vaccine for immunocompromised patients, booster for chronic lymphocytic leukemia patients, and booster for healthy adults previously vaccinated with mRNA vaccines.
  • Primary funding sources come from governmental agencies and academic/research institutions through collaboration agreements rather than traditional commercial customers.
  • In July 2025, GeoVax initiated a research program to evaluate needle-free, self-administered GEO-MVA vaccine delivery via Vaxxas' microarray patch technology for pandemic preparedness.
  • In September 2025, GeoVax completed a $2.5 million registered direct offering to institutional investors at $0.63 per share with accompanying warrants.
